Research

In our theory group we study fundamental properties of soft active materials. This new class of materials is characterized by local energy injection that leads to novel non-equilibrium phenomena. Most living matter is "active" and there are ample examples of synthetic active materials.

We are interested in developing a thermodynamic framework for these systems, with focus on active field theories.

We are also studying a subclass of active materials are chiral. These exhibits extraordinary properties such as a new type of viscosity that do not dissipate energy (odd viscosity). 

For the more biological context we investigate active gels and active polar liquid crystals.
